Re: 64 Plymouth Belvedere post car
Xmas is a rare occasion were i find that i have a bit of spare time ...Car never had an emergency brake or hand brake whatever you call them these days and the new floor came without the cable brackets so a bit of a mock up and a few spot welds later and we have the start of a handbrake cable ....few updates coming over the next few days as i strip out all the running gear to prep for chassis paint...Not sure if the cable goes in the bottom hole or top in last photo ,

Re: 64 Plymouth Belvedere post car
Thanks Blue ,be in touch straight after xmas about the box ...need to keep hold of it for a few weeks for a mock up ...These 64s have a disliking to some boxes I have been told so I have got to find out what year it is so I can get the correct mount for the crossmember I have ,,,The crossmember it came with had been butchered to fit .I have since landed the correct one for the year but it does not like the gearbox I have ...I know why the old one was butchered now LOL ...anyways its a solvable problem with some googling until then have a good xmas and a healthy new year

Re: 64 Plymouth Belvedere post car
Pretty sure the later boxes bolt straight in to the early mount. If your current mount has been butchered to fit, I think I know why. The early B bodies have the engine mounted 2 inches further forward meaning expensive headers. Later K frames bolt straight in, move the engine back 2 inches giving better weight distribution and any of the cheaper later headers fit. The upshot of doing that is the gearbox mount is now 2 inches further back so the crossmember needs modification to fit. This is how Jem's car was.
